State v. Nissen

This court case is relevant to the policy regarding warrantless arrests. It states that police must have probable cause to make an arrest, even without a warrant.

Riverside v. McLaughlin

This Supreme Court case established that a person's detention without probable cause is an unlawful seizure under the Fourth Amendment. It's relevant for warrantless arrests because probable cause is needed to detain someone.

Nebraska Revised Statutes §29-410

This Nebraska statute outlines the legal grounds for making an arrest without a warrant. It involves situations where a crime occurs in the officer's presence or when there's a strong reason to believe the person committed a felony.

Study Notes

Omaha Police Department General Order 15-24

  • Subject: Arrest Affidavit/Order (Warrantless)
  • Effective Date: 23 February 2024
  • Amends: General Order #25-22
  • Policy Revision: This order modifies the procedures for handling warrantless arrest affidavits/orders, primarily focusing on routing and completion.

Policy Changes

  • Email Routing: Officers must now email copies of the Affidavit/Order to the Duty Judge and OPD Records Squad.
  • Arrest Affidavit/Order (OPD Form 156A): Required for all non-warrant felony arrests to ensure detention does not exceed 48 hours without judicial review.
  • Warrant Arrests: This form (156A) is not required for warrant arrests. If an arrest has a warrant, relevant policy applies.

Procedure - Completing the Form

  • OPD Officers: Responsible for completing the Warrantless Arrest Affidavit/Order Form (156A) for non-warrant felony arrests.
  • Synopsis Requirement: Officers must include a brief synopsis of the incident and the probable cause for the arrest on the affidavit.
  • Standing Alone Report: The 156A must stand alone as a report submitted to the duty judge for review.
  • Time Sensitivity: The form must be completed by the arresting officer, regardless of arrest time.

Procedure - Routing & Additional Info

  • Emailing: The completed and notarized affidavit must be immediately emailed to the Duty Judge, along with a copy to the OPD Records Squad.
  • Alternative: If email is unavailable, the form must still be delivered to the duty judge within 24 hours, utilizing alternative methods such as interdepartmental mail.
  • DCDC Procedures: When an arrestee is booked at Douglas County Department of Corrections (DCDC), a copy of the completed and notarized affidavit is provided to DCDC admissions staff. DCDC staff verifies the completeness of the form before accepting the arrestee.
  • PDF Format: Officers must send copies in PDF format, and at DCDC, the scanner/printer automatically converts the doc to PDF while emailing.
  • Subject Line: The subject line for emailed forms must be "Warrantless Arrest Affidavit" for all cases.
  • Notarization: Completion and notarization of the Affidavit/Order Form are required.
  • Form Completion: Complete the form before accepting an arrestee for booking.
  • Missing Pages: Ensure no pages are missing before scanning, emailing, or faxing the affidavit/order.
  • Other Policies: Officer should consult related policies regarding warrants, applications, filing, and booking procedures.
  • Electronic Submission: Officers must submit their reports to the Electronic Reporting System by the end of their shift.

Additional Notes

  • The Duty Judge decides if probable cause exists in such arrests to release the individual.
  • The use of witness/victim identifiers (victim #1, witness #2, etc.) is clarified.
  • This order outlines procedures for warrantless arrests.
  • Specific email addresses are included for the Duty Judge and records.
